I Overheard My Husband Ordering a New TV and PlayStation with My College Fund — He Was Gravely Mistaken

I’m Emma, a mother of three who had long dreamed of returning to school to change my career. I had spent years working part-time, saving every penny to fund my education and make a better life for my family. But when my husband Jack ordered a new TV and PlayStation with my hard-earned savings, everything changed.

One evening, while cleaning, I overheard Jack on the phone with his friend Adam. I froze when Jack said, “Do you think I’d let her spend that money on studying when I have an old TV and PlayStation? I already ordered them with her money.”

Fury surged through me. That money wasn’t for his luxuries—it was for my future. I quickly hid the TV and PlayStation in the basement, then called the retailer to cancel the order. The customer service representative helped me redirect the refund to my account, ensuring my money would be safe.

A few days later, Jack came home furious, demanding to know where the items were. I told him I sold them, then revealed that I’d canceled the order and secured the refund. He exploded in anger, accusing me of overstepping, but I stood my ground.

Despite his outrage, I stayed focused. I had a scholarship application in progress, and soon, I received the good news—I’d been awarded the scholarship I needed to start my courses. Jack wasn’t happy about it, but I was determined.

When I told him about the scholarship, he was angry and tried to guilt-trip me. “Who’s going to take care of the kids while you’re off playing student?” he asked. I calmly replied, “I’ll manage. I’ve planned for this.”

The next few months were tense. Jack barely spoke to me, but I kept my eyes on the goal. Finally, one evening, Jack admitted he’d been wrong. He’d spoken to Adam and realized how important this was for me. We started to talk things through, and though it wasn’t easy, we began to work together again as a team.

I balanced school, kids, and home life, and Jack stepped up to help more. We became stronger as a family, and one day, I received a message from Jack and the kids, holding a sign that said, “We’re proud of you, Emma!”

It was a reminder of how far we’d come. Sometimes, you have to make difficult decisions to protect your future, but with courage and determination, anything is possible.
